SLIPPERY ROCK, Pennsylvania - Police are investigating an apparent double murder near Slippery Rock.

On Thursday, police found the charred remains of Kenneth and Celeste Abbott on their property in Brady township near Slippery Rock.

Soon after, 40-year-old Colin Abbot was arrested in New Jersey and charged with killing his father and step-mother.

Trooper Ronald Kesten of the Pennslvania State Police, Butler barracks, told 21 News that "based on information gathered through out the investigation, Colin Abbott of Randolph, New Jersey has been taken into custody."

Family friend, Nicke Hufnage, says "my dad would stop over there to say, hey where's Ken and Celeste?  He was living there and he said they'd passed away."

Colin had apparently told family members the couple died July 12th in a car crash in New Jersey.

Nervous family members contacted police in New Jersey but, they had no reports of an accident.

During a search of Colin Abbots New Jersey home police found his step-mother's wallet along with a gun case for a .38 caliber hand gun.
